If you happen to be going through a divorce and want to write a new will that removes your ex as a beneficiary or a medical power of attorney holder or a living will trustee, DO NOT use this firm. I was wanting to remove my soon-to-be ex husband from these things to ensure he didn't benefit from my death, nor see to it that I did die. His lawyers answer to that was that I needed to wait because he would only get half and my children would get the other half after going through the stress and expense of probate. I'm sure he would volunteer to handle that probate and eat up as much of my estate as he could.
Owner response
Tracy, I'm sorry you feel this way. I talked to the person who you talked to and I listened to the phone call myself. <br>Please know that you hung up on him within 90 seconds. No real questions were asked, and no real answers were given in that short period of time. That said, I understand your frustration, but because you hung up within about 90 seconds of the call starting, our recommendation couldn't be fully explained. There's some nuance here, which I will explain in further detail below. <br>That said, with the limited information I have ...<br>You do not have to wait to do an estate plan that disinherits your soon to be ex-husband. You can do that today and do a Will that disinherits him. You don't have to wait for anything to do that. All you have to do is disinherit him from receiving anything in your estate. However, because Arizona is a community property state, you have to do this in stages. First, come in (or go anywhere) now and do a Will that's generic in terms of just disinheriting your soon to be ex-husband and that gives your entire estate (whatever that may be) to whoever you want. <br>Second, after the divorce is finalized and you have a property separation order, you come in (or go anywhere) again and do another estate plan giving whatever you want to whoever you want because then you'll know what assets you have control over. <br>If you have any other questions about this, please feel free to call back and ask for me (Doug Newborn). I don't expect you to hire us, but I'll answer your questions for free and give you a couple great estate planning attorney names as referrals. <br>Again, I'm sorry for any inconvenience we caused Tracy and I hope the above is helpful for you.
